Garden District Condos-1627 Conery St.-Historic Condo Renovation! What do you get for $192,500?

    This exciting condo at 1627 Conery Street in the New Orleans Garden District is a new listing of mine.  This is a great example in how we in New Orleans love to keep these old buildings and reuse them.  The developer really has gone  the extra mile to leave the old fireplaces with the exposed brick, wood plank floors while at the same time giving people what they want.  This is what we like about Historic Renovations. 

     The unit was renovated down to the studs meaning new electrical, new a/c-heater, new water pipes and much more.  At the same time people want new kitchens, new baths, crown molding and lots of windows.  I would guess this building was about 80 years old.

1627 Conery Condo, New Orleans Garden District Condo

     This Garden District condo has two bedroom and one bath and is in a great location.  You are within half a block of St. Charles Ave. and public transportation via the New Orleans Street car line.  There is no parking but street parking in front of the unit does not seem to be an issue.  Most people living here would love to park and walk.

   The Condo features include 12 foot ceilings, crown molding, recessed lighting, renovated windows that work, under counter lighting, ceiling fans, custom cabinets, travertine tiles, upscale granite counter tops, new stainless steel appliances, and windows that still work.  Whenever you have windows with natural light and high ceilings the unit lives much larger than the 753 sq. ft. of living.  The condo fees are reasonable at $187 per month.  This cover insurance, flood insurance, water and up keep. The building has never flooded.  Read the rest of this entry »

New Orleans Condos, Perfect for students, persons getting started or a weekend retreat! Has all the Pluses!

      Every once in a while you list an Uptown New Orleans condo that will fit several clients needs.  The 4239 St. Charles Ave Condos or the Hawthorne Condos has a lot of positive things that people are looking for.  This is the case of a new listing that I just got at 4239  St. Charles Ave near Napoleon Ave.   The building is about 80 years old and is a medium size condo association.

      Its on the Mardi Gras parade route, the street car route and halfway between Tulane, Loyola and downtown New Orleans.  Its priced to sell. The only negative is that the kitchen and applicances need updating.  Its $185,239, its my price so I believe its right on the money. See more photos on my website. 4239 St. Charles Ave. The Hawthorne Condos.

    This unit would make a great home for a college student.  A nice condo for a resident or medical student at Tulane or LSU.  Great second home in New Orleans.  Good place to get started for people needing a one bedroom in Uptown.

Cotton Mill Condos, Warehouse District Condos-Great City Views from corner unit.

     This is a new listing in the New Orleans Warehouse District that I picked up today that I wanted to share since it is such a special unit.  The Warehouse feel comes alive in this corner unit #368 in the Cotton Mill Condos on the 3rd floor.  City View are out of site day and night.  With at least ten 15ft window you get plenty of light. 

     You get the 18′ high ceiling, exposed beams, brick exterior, a new kitchen, new appliances, new floors and carpets.  The entire unit was redone in 2006 down to the studs after Katrina.  Its a well kept unit where a professional stagger could not have done better.  The two bedroom unit has a large 1191 sq. ft. of living area with 2 bedrooms and 2 baths. Price $349,368.
